Kannada-English dictionary
Source: Alar: Kannada-English corpusHaraḍe (ಹರಡೆ):—[noun] = ಹರಡು [haradu]3.
--- OR ---
Haraḍe (ಹರಡೆ):—[noun] a species of small owl, that is supposed to give indication of what will happen in future.
--- OR ---
Haraḍe (ಹರಡೆ):—[noun] the plant Terminalia chebula of Combretaceae family and its nut; ink nut; black myrobalan.
--- OR ---
Harade (ಹರದೆ):—[noun] = ಹರದಿ [haradi].
